Charles P.
Durkin is a Senior Advisor at Saratoga Management Co. LLC since 1984.
He was a Director at Emeritus Corp.
from 1999 to 2010.
He also worked as a Managing Director at SBC Warburg Dillon Read Corporate Finance AG.
Durkin holds an MBA from The Trustees of Columbia University in The City of New York and an undergraduate degree from Princeton University.

Saratoga Management Co. LLC
Saratoga Management Co. LLC Investment ManagersFinance Saratoga Management invests in small and middle markets companies located in the United States with an EBITDA of USD 5 - 40 million. The firm focuses on media & telecommunications, industrial manufacturing, business services and information service sectors. It provides financing in the form of debt and equity for buyout, bankruptcy reorganizations and auctions, traditional and negotiated failed-financing/distressed investing and growth stage capital requirements with an investment size of USD 50 - 500 million.
